Output 8026beb59896cb6624b07bb32f9993436487d71d51b765e4db851a0cccb4194b:1

value
11336159
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d9c57310e88b9754a6c9e5a5962fd5c139ae862 OP_EQUALVERIFY OP_CHECKSIG
address
16cmWSKCeEheRYf255jR4tbWHdfydFQPKN
transaction
8026beb59896cb6624b07bb32f9993436487d71d51b765e4db851a0cccb4194b
spent
true